Understand Dental Implants
When considering dental implants, it is very important to comprehend what they're and how they function. Basically, oral implants are man-made tooth roots made from titanium, developed to support replacement teeth or bridges.
These implants are operatively placed into your jawbone, where they fuse with the bone in time, providing a strong and stable structure for your brand-new teeth.

Gather Medical History
Gathering your medical history is a crucial step in preparing for a dental implant examination. Your dental professional will certainly need a comprehensive understanding of your overall wellness to determine if you're an appropriate candidate for implants.
Start by noting any type of present drugs, including over the counter medicines and supplements. Also, note any kind of allergies, particularly to anesthetic or antibiotics, as this information can considerably affect your treatment strategy.
Next off, think about your clinical problems. Problems like diabetic issues, heart problem, or autoimmune conditions can influence recovery and the success of implants. Be truthful regarding your smoking routines, as cigarette use can make complex healing.

Bring any relevant medical records or examination results to your visit, as these can provide your dental professional with important understandings.
Finally, think about family members medical history. If any type of loved ones have experienced problems with dental treatments, sharing this details can help your dental practitioner examine prospective risks.
